CA Index Name: Platinum, dichlorobis(triphenylphosphine)-, (SP-4-1)-
Other Names: Platinum, dichlorobis(triphenylphosphine)-, trans- (8CI) ; trans-Bis(triphenylphosphine)platinum dichloride ; trans-Dichlorobis(triphenylphosphine)platinum ; trans-Dichlorobis(triphenylphosphine-P)platinum(II)
Class Identifier: Coordination Compound
Molecular Formula: C36H30Cl2P2Pt
Molecular Weight: 790.55
Melting Point: ≥300 °C(lit.)
Flash Point: 181.7 °C
Enthalpy of Vaporization: 58.18 kJ/mol
Boiling Point: 360 °C at 760 mmHg
Vapour Pressure: 4.74E-05 mmHg at 25°C
Product Categories: Catalysis and Inorganic Chemistry ; Chemical Synthesis ; Platinum

Safty information about Platinum, dichlorobis(triphenylphosphine)-, (SP-4-1)- (CAS NO.14056-88-3) is:
Hazard Codes:
Xi
Risk Statements:
R36/37/38:Irritating to eyes, respiratory system and skin.
Safety Statements:
S26: In case of contact with eyes, rinse immediately with plenty of water and seek medical advice.
S37/39:Wear suitable gloves and eye/face protection.
WGK Germany: 3
Platinum, dichlorobis(triphenylphosphine)-, (SP-4-1)- (CAS NO.14056-88-3) is a white powder.
